60 days skill development training concludes

ITANAGAR, Apr 4: The 60 days Skill Development programme on cane and bamboo conducted at Palin by Rural Development and Heritage Society (RDHS) concluded recently. The programme was sponsored by Small Industries Development of India (SIDBI) Branch office Itanagar Arunachal Pradesh.
During the concluding programme Tamchi Yaniang, Gram Panchayat Member (GPM) old Palin distributed course certificate to the trainees and thanked the Branch Managers SIDBI for sponsoring training in the backward area for the benefits of the village men and women. She requested SIDBI to sponsor advance training to the village youths in coming days.
Tamchi Posi from Sangram Kurung Kumey District and Ranjiv Das from Assam was the resource person of the training. Tamchi Niania, chairman Rural Development and Heritage Society also spoke on the occasion.
